Balotelli hits back at Carragher: 'Who cares' about opinion of a 'bad player'
Mario Balotelli only concerns himself with the opinions of quality players, and former Liverpool defender Jamie Carragher apparently doesn't fit that description.
The Italian striker, who left Anfield for French side Nice on transfer deadline day after enduring a miserable spell with the Reds, was castigated by Carragher and Stan Collymore in the aftermath of the move.

The former quipped that the free transfer was still an overpay by Nice, while the latter said the 26-year-old should retire instead of trying to revive his career.
Saturday, Balotelli hit back on Twitter:
Jamie Carragher, bad player, wonderful hater @Carra23 ,who cares. pic.twitter.com/onbY0WUgOc
— Mario Balotelli (@FinallyMario) September 3, 2016
